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
C++使用protobuf实现序列化与反序列化
一 protobuf简介 1 1 protobuf的定义 protobuf是用来干嘛的 protobuf是一种用于 对结构数据进行序列化的工具 从而实现 数据存储和交换 主要用于网络通信中 收发两端进行消息交互 所谓的 结构数据 是指类似于
开源组件
c
Protobuf
近一月翻阅资料小结
近一个月接触的东西比较多 梳理一下 Nginx Tomcat 实现负载均衡 同时采用keepalived的形式实现HA 负载后 关键问题就是session共享的问题 可实现的思路较多 Tomcat6以后本身可以使用cluster技术达成 也
开源组件
MapReduce
Redis
MongoDB
memcached
基于SpringBoot-Dubbo的微服务快速开发框架
简介 基于Dubbo的分布式 微服务基础框架 为前端提供脚手架开发服务 结合前一篇 Web AP快速开发基础框架 可快速上手基于Dubbo的分布式服务开发 项目代码 https github com backkoms web service
spring boot
开源组件
架构
dubbo
微服务
公众号开放,关注软件开发过程中的哪些坑
一位十年码农的碎碎念 扫码关注获取更多精彩内容
spring boot
开源组件
Windows下jsp运行环境的配置方案
Windows下jsp运行环境的配置方案 lt 一 gt 配置前的准备工作 软件名称 j2sdk 安装包名称 j2sdk 1 4 2 windows i586 exe 下载地址 http java sun com 软件名称 Jakarta
Java
开源组件
web开发
jsp
Windows
etcd键值操作
etcd 删除键值 1 查询所有键值 curl http 10 0 2 255 9001 v2 keys services recursive true 2 删除键值 curl http 10 0 22 39 9001 v2 keys ke
开源组件
etcd
java.util.zip.ZipException: invalid LOC header (bad signature)
java util zip ZipException invalid LOC header bad signature maven项目打包时 jar包本身损坏 需要将本地repository中的jar相关文件清除 重新从remote rep
开源组件
Java
jenkins升级
jenkins升级 最关心的问题莫过于其中的job保存住 新版本中启动后可以直接使用 答案是可以的 以centos为例 不管是war部署到tomcat下面启动 还是直接通过java jar 方式启动 默认初始化目录都在 root jenki
开源组件
jenkins升级
Tomcat中配置SSL
Tomcat网站上 http tomcat apache org tomcat 5 5 doc ssl howto html Edit 20the 20Tomcat 20Configuration 20File 有相关配置SSL的介绍 建议
开源组件
web开发
tomcat
Ubuntu
Web
xtrabackup 全量备份、恢复数据
1 全量备份 root localhost lib innobackupex defaults file defaults file user mysql username password mysql password stream ta
开源组件
数据库
XtraBackup
innodbbackup
mysql全量备份
Spring boot ,dubbo整合异常
Caused by java lang IllegalArgumentException java lang ClassCastException com guooo boot acc serv impl HelloDubboService
spring boot
开源组件
Java
Bean property 'transactionManagerBeanName' is not writable or has an invalid set
2017 02 07 11 38 48 458 localhost startStop 1 org springframework beans factory support DefaultListableBeanFactory 523 D
开源组件
transactionManagerBeanName
springorm
JSch-用java实现服务器远程操作
介绍 前段时间接了一个比较特殊的需求 需要做一个用于部署服务的服务 主要是将一个k8s服务集群部署到远端的服务器上 具体服务器的连接信息会通过接口传入 本来部署是人工来完成的 无非是将一些必须的文件scp到目标服务器上 然后ssh远程登录
Java
开源组件
jsch
SSH
redhat中文文件名、文件夹乱码问题解决
redhat在没有安装中文rpm包之前 中文会显示为乱码的小方块字样 利用ssh客户端在上传中文文件名的文件或文件夹时 均不能识别中文 给开发应用造成很大的困扰 首先安装fonts chinese 3 02 9 6 el5 noarch r
开源组件
Linux
redhat
spring boot admin抛出"status":401,"error":"Unauthorized"异常
打开spring boot admin的监控平台发现其监控的服务明细打开均抛出异常 Error timestamp 1502749349892 status 401 error Unauthorized message Full authe
spring cloud
spring boot
开源组件
spring boot admin
401
Build step 'Record JaCoCo coverage report' changed build result to UNSTABLE
状况 这个异常jenkins job build黄色提示 原因就是加入了 这个打钩如下 去掉就行了 会如图1 和 min max值比较 产生unstable状态 JaCoCo plugin Thresholds JacocoHealthRe
开源组件
测试
主机地址变更后,dubbo请求时依旧会寻址旧IP的问题
机房迁移 导致测试服务器IP变更 比原于IP为192 168 1 105变更为10 1 9 120 服务源码未做任何变更 启动服务时依旧是旧地址请求 此问题由dubbo本地注册中心的缓存所致 清理掉即可 位置一般在于 用户目录 dubbo目
开源组件
dubbo
dubbo缓存
centos 上安装redis 3.0.5
官网下载安装包 直接使用make编译 报如下错误 root localhost redis 3 0 5 make cd src make all make 1 进入目录 usr local opentest redis 3 0 5 src
开源组件
Linux
centOS
Redis
GitHub代码阅读神器,你值有拥有!
题图 from github Github作为全球最大的程序员聚集地 已经成为学习开发技能的绝佳伴侣 如果你是程序员 但你还没有账户的话 这里建议你去signup 毕竟能增加成长的机会 不能错过 由于是在线Web应用 阅读代码时极不方便 再
开源组件
GitHub
代码阅读
架构
KETTLE 异常处理
kettle未能正常执行任务时 同样需要记录下来执行操作 以便分析任务异常 红色线条代表任务异常时执行的任务 绿色为正常执行的任务序列 任务执行时都有日志记录 但kettle日志表中字段存在执行时间 但不存在业务日期字段 比如今天的任务执行
开源组件
Kettle
日志处理